'''Wrebbit, Inc''' was a now-discontinued, [puzzle](/source/puzzle)-making company best known for its ''[Puzz 3D](/source/Puzz_3D)'' [puzzle](/source/puzzle)s. The company was founded in [Montreal](/source/Montreal), [Quebec](/source/Quebec), by [Paul Gallant](/source/Paul_Gallant), and marketed itself as "The Puzzle Innovators". Its namesake appears to stem from the fact that the company's [mascot](/source/mascot) is a green [frog](/source/frog), and "Wrebbit" is either an alternative spelling or possibly a play-on words of the word ''ribbit''.

In the late 1990s, all of three-dimensional puzzles were a successful fad, leading to a rapid growth in the company. In 2001, the business was bought by [Irwin Toy](/source/Irwin_Toy). When Irwin Toy filed for bankruptcy a year later, Gallant bought back the business and relaunched it in a much reduced state. In 2005, the business was bought by the US-based [Hasbro](/source/Hasbro), which moved the manufacture of Wrebbit's puzzles to its facility in [East Longmeadow, Massachusetts](/source/East_Longmeadow%2C_Massachusetts), in 2006.

Gallant died on September 13, 2011.<ref name=tg>{{cite news|title=Famous Puzz 3D Inventor Dies at 67 |url=http://toysandgamesmagazine.ca/9404/famous-puzz-3d-inventor-dies-at-67/ |website=Toys & Games |publisher=Playtonic Communications |date=September 14, 2011|access-date=September 24, 2011}}</ref> In 2012, Gallant's son and a partner who worked for Wrebbit revived the Wrebbit name and founded Wrebbit 3D Puzzle, producing the same type of puzzle as ''Puzz 3D''.
